The iEvent Conference Format
Conference formats can vary, but iEvent Conferences generally follow a similar structure. There are keynotes from industry thought leaders, offering inspiration and insights into the future of events. Workshops provide hands-on training on specific skills like event design, budget management, and social media marketing. Panel discussions bring together experts to debate current trends and challenges. Networking sessions offer plenty of opportunities to connect with peers, potential clients, and industry partners. There are also usually exhibition areas where vendors showcase the latest event technology and services. The whole format is designed to be engaging, informative, and collaborative, with something for everyone. From big conference halls to small breakout sessions, you can tailor your experience to match your interests. Often, you can find a virtual option which gives you access from anywhere in the world!

Before the Conference
Preparing for an iEvent Conference can make your experience much more productive. Before the event, browse the conference website to familiarize yourself with the agenda, speakers, and exhibitors. Identify the sessions and workshops you want to attend and create a schedule. Plan the key questions you want to ask during Q&A sessions or networking breaks. Pack comfortable shoes, business cards, and any materials or technology you may need. Download the conference app, if available, as it can provide you with information about the schedule, speaker bios, and maps. Review the list of attendees and identify people you'd like to meet. By planning ahead, you can ensure that you maximize your learning and networking opportunities at the conference.

After the Conference
After the iEvent Conference, the work isn't done! Follow up with the connections you made during the event. Send personalized emails, connect on LinkedIn, and build on the relationships you started. Review your notes and identify key takeaways that you can implement in your work. Share your experience on social media. Evaluate the information and skills that you gained. Consider creating a plan that would allow you to implement the best ideas from the conference. This can involve setting goals, creating new strategies, and developing action plans.
